Educational and Experience Requirement:Associates degree in a related field. Bachelor’s degree preferred. Must hold intermediate peace officer certification issued by the Texas Commission on Law Enforcement (TCOLE). Five years of law enforcement experience required. Must successfully pass SHSU Police Department Field Training program within department parameters. Must stay up-to-date with any continuing education, training, or recertification processes necessary to keep required license/certification valid.
Must be a current Sam Houston State University employee in order to be considered for this position.
Performs supervisory level work for the Sam Houston State University Police department. Performs regular patrols to prevent crime, suppress disturbances, arrest offenders, and give aid and information to all citizens as circumstances require. Enforces all University, State and local laws.
Primary Responsibilities:Plans, organizes, leads, directs, controls and assesses all regulatory activities in an assigned operational area. Checks for adherence to performance standards, personal appearance and conduct of subordinates. Performs evaluations of subordinates’ work. Assists in the recruitment, interviewing and pre-employment investigations of new personnel. Works with local law enforcement personnel, judges, district attorneys, colleges and other officials. Helps maintain good departmental image. Performs other related duties as assigned.
Other Specifications:Thorough knowledge of and skills in the use of firearms, radar equipment, criminal investigation equipment, photographic equipment, radio equipment, alarm systems, defensive devices, telephone switchboards, typewriter, and emergency motor vehicles. Proficiency in all phases of work performed. Exposure to outside weather conditions. May be required to work during night hours. Work involves a degree of hazard. Must have a pleasant, courteous disposition and express at all times the desire to render accurate and cheerful service. Has contacts with off campus agencies, state and local law enforcement agencies, vendors, and courts. Alertness and careful attention in the performance of duties is required to prevent injury to self and others. This position may be designated as a Campus Security Authority (CSA).
